About M. J. Singleton

M. J. Singleton is a scholar working on Geochemistry and Petrology, Environmental Engineering, Global and Planetary Change, Inorganic Chemistry and Civil and Structural Engineering, having authored 54 papers that have together received 1.2k indexed citations. Recurring topics across this work include Groundwater and Isotope Geochemistry (31 papers), Groundwater flow and contamination studies (25 papers), Radioactive contamination and transfer (13 papers), Radioactive element chemistry and processing (11 papers), Isotope Analysis in Ecology (7 papers), Atmospheric and Environmental Gas Dynamics (7 papers), Soil and Unsaturated Flow (6 papers) and Soil and Water Nutrient Dynamics (3 papers). The work is most often cited by research in Geochemistry and Petrology (541 citations), Environmental Engineering (453 citations), Environmental Chemistry (287 citations), Water Science and Technology (253 citations) and Global and Planetary Change (238 citations). M. J. Singleton has collaborated with scholars based in United States, Malaysia and Austria. Frequent co-authors include J. E. Moran, B. K. Esser, W. W. McNab, Mark E. Conrad, Donald J. DePaolo, Erik Oerter, G.W. Gee, P.L. Hageman, Christopher T. Green and R. N. Clark. Their work appears in journals such as Applied Geochemistry, Vadose Zone Journal, Environmental Science & Technology, ACS Omega and Journal of Hydrology.
